Dayton Children’s is a 155 bed referral center, drawing patients from a 20-county area in Southwestern Ohio and Eastern Indiana. The Wright State University Department of Pediatrics and its residency program is based at Dayton Children’s. There are residents in pediatrics, medicine/pediatrics, general surgery, orthopedics and others in training at Dayton Children’s Within this academic setting, and all medical specialties are represented.

Children’s Mercy Hospitals & Clinics is a free-standing, independent pediatric clinical, academic and research medical center with two hospitals which are located in Kansas City, MO, and Overland Park, KS. Clinical services include more than 40 pediatric subspecialties. Our patient population draws from 150 counties in Missouri and Kansas, and from adjoining states. A new patient tower will increase our capacity to nearly 400 licensed beds. We continue to expand our institutional research capacity and capabilities through our work with colleagues at UMKC, University of Kansas and the Stower’s Institute. Marine Corps Community Services, Camp Lejeune is a service organization. Our mission is to promote the readiness and retention of Marines and their families by delivering programs, products and services of value to the Camp Lejeune community and to do so in a manner that makes a positive difference in the lives of the people our organization exists to serve.
